Richard Archibald Zoll (December 10, 1913 – September 6, 1985) was an American professional football player in the National Football League (NFL) for the Cleveland Rams and Green Bay Packers from 1937 to 1939 as a guard and tackle. He played at the collegiate level at Indiana University-Bloomington.[1] He was also the brother of original Packers Martin and Carl Zoll.[2]
